TWI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review
183 of the 8,187 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Titan International (TWI)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$406M — down 10% from $453M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 30 funds opened new TWI posit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 59 added to existing stakes and 58 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Donald Smith & Co, adding an estimated $13M. The largest seller was AIP LLC, cutting an estimated $27.3M.
